#72cf55 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#72cf55 is composed of 44.7% red, 81.2%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.9%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 105.7 degrees, a saturation of 56% and a lightness of 57.3%. #72cf55 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ffaa with #009f00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#72cf55

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060e04 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#72cf55

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919490 is the less saturated color, while #5cf92b is the most saturated one.
